Chicago Bulls Play Down To The Competition Again In Loss To Hornets

29 Nov 2025

Description

The Chicago Bulls dropped a frustrating one to the Charlotte Hornets, losing 123–116 in a game filled with missed chances, shaky defense, and late-game breakdowns. Haize dives deep into what went wrong, what (surprisingly) went right, and what this loss reveals about where the Bulls truly stand.In this episode, we break down:🐂 Slow Starts & Streaky Offense — Why the Bulls struggled to create separation and relied too heavily on iso scoring🛑 Defensive Slippage — How poor rotations, transition lapses, and lack of physicality allowed the Hornets to control key stretches🔄 Rotation & Lineup Questions — Who earned more minutes, who didn’t show up, and what adjustments Billy Donovan may be forced into⭐ Individual Performances — The bright spots, the frustrations, and the players trending in the wrong direction📉 What This Means Moving Forward — Are the Bulls running out of time to fix their identity?No sugarcoating.
